Unlock the Future: Mastering AI Integration with Azure Gateway
Introduction
In today's rapidly evolving technological landscape, the integration of Artificial Intelligence (AI) into business operations has become a necessity rather than a luxury. The Azure Gateway, an essential component of Microsoft's cloud computing platform, serves as a robust tool for managing AI services and APIs. This article delves into the intricacies of AI Gateway, API Gateway, and the Azure Gateway, providing insights into how they can be leveraged to unlock the full potential of AI in your organization. We will also explore the capabilities of APIPark, an open-source AI gateway and API management platform, which can significantly enhance your AI integration efforts.
Understanding AI Gateway and API Gateway
AI Gateway
An AI Gateway is a specialized type of API Gateway designed to facilitate the integration of AI services into existing IT infrastructures. It acts as a bridge between AI applications and the backend systems, ensuring seamless communication and efficient data processing. The primary functions of an AI Gateway include:
- Authentication and Authorization: Ensuring secure access to AI services.
- Data Routing: Directing requests to the appropriate AI service based on predefined rules.
- Data Transformation: Converting data formats to be compatible with AI services.
- Performance Monitoring: Tracking the performance of AI services to ensure optimal operation.
API Gateway
An API Gateway serves as a single entry point for all API requests, providing a centralized location for managing and securing APIs. It plays a crucial role in API management by handling tasks such as:
- Request Routing: Directing API requests to the appropriate backend service.
- Security: Implementing authentication, authorization, and rate limiting to protect APIs.
- Caching: Storing frequently accessed data to improve performance.
- Monitoring: Tracking API usage and performance to identify potential issues.
APIPark is a high-performance AI gateway that allows you to securely access the most comprehensive LLM APIs globally on the APIPark platform, including OpenAI, Anthropic, Mistral, Llama2, Google Gemini, and more.Try APIPark now! πππ
The Azure Gateway: A Comprehensive Solution
Microsoft's Azure Gateway is a powerful tool that combines the functionalities of an AI Gateway and an API Gateway. It offers a wide range of features designed to simplify the integration of AI services into your Azure environment. Some of the key features of the Azure Gateway include:
- Unified Management: Centralized management of AI services and APIs.
- Scalability: Ability to scale AI services and APIs based on demand.
- Security: Robust security measures to protect AI services and APIs.
- Integration: Seamless integration with other Azure services.
Leveraging APIPark for Enhanced AI Integration
APIPark is an open-source AI gateway and API management platform that can significantly enhance your AI integration efforts. With its extensive range of features, APIPark offers a comprehensive solution for managing AI services and APIs. Here are some of the key features of APIPark:
| Feature | Description |
|---|---|
| Quick Integration of AI Models | APIPark offers the capability to integrate a variety of AI models with a unified management system for authentication and cost tracking. |
| Unified API Format for AI Invocation | It standardizes the request data format across all AI models, ensuring that changes in AI models or prompts do not affect the application or microservices. |
| Prompt Encapsulation into REST API | Users can quickly combine AI models with custom prompts to create new APIs, such as sentiment analysis, translation, or data analysis APIs. |
| End-to-End API Lifecycle Management | APIPark assists with managing the entire lifecycle of APIs, including design, publication, invocation, and decommission. |
| API Service Sharing within Teams | The platform allows for the centralized display of all API services, making it easy for different departments and teams to find and use the required API services. |
APIPark Deployment
Deploying APIPark is a straightforward process that can be completed in just 5 minutes with a single command line:
curl -sSO https://download.apipark.com/install/quick-start.sh; bash quick-start.sh
Conclusion
The integration of AI into business operations has become a necessity in today's digital age. The Azure Gateway and APIPark provide powerful tools for managing AI services and APIs, enabling organizations to unlock the full potential of AI. By leveraging these tools, businesses can streamline their operations, improve efficiency, and gain a competitive edge in the market.
FAQs
Q1: What is the difference between an AI Gateway and an API Gateway? A1: An AI Gateway is a specialized type of API Gateway designed to facilitate the integration of AI services, while an API Gateway serves as a single entry point for all API requests, providing a centralized location for managing and securing APIs.
Q2: What are the key features of the Azure Gateway? A2: The Azure Gateway offers unified management, scalability, security, and seamless integration with other Azure services.
Q3: How can APIPark enhance AI integration efforts? A3: APIPark offers a comprehensive solution for managing AI services and APIs, including quick integration of AI models, unified API format for AI invocation, prompt encapsulation into REST API, and end-to-end API lifecycle management.
Q4: What is the deployment process for APIPark? A4: APIPark can be deployed in just 5 minutes with a single command line: curl -sSO https://download.apipark.com/install/quick-start.sh; bash quick-start.sh.
Q5: What is the value of APIPark for enterprises? A5: APIPark's powerful API governance solution can enhance efficiency, security, and data optimization for developers, operations personnel, and business managers alike.
πYou can securely and efficiently call the OpenAI API on APIPark in just two steps:
Step 1: Deploy the APIPark AI gateway in 5 minutes.
APIPark is developed based on Golang, offering strong product performance and low development and maintenance costs. You can deploy APIPark with a single command line.
curl -sSO https://download.apipark.com/install/quick-start.sh; bash quick-start.sh

In my experience, you can see the successful deployment interface within 5 to 10 minutes. Then, you can log in to APIPark using your account.

Step 2: Call the OpenAI API.
